Assemblyman Michael Blake held his ‘Celebrations of Legends: Past, Present and Future’ Black History Month Celebration on Saturday, February 27 at the Claremont Neighborhood Center to honor the contributions made by many local African American veterans. Joining the assemblyman in celebrating the service our nation’s heroes, Borough President Ruben Diaz, Jr.; Councilwoman Vanessa Gibson and Councilman Andy King were in attendance to meet with the veterans and present them citations recognizing their bravery. In addition, the ceremony included discussions for economic development, education and equality for all while celebrating the advances made in the African American community.
